MS Windows: מערכת הפעלה זו שוללת את עולם שולחן העבודה, אך יש עוד דברים ללמוד

גילוי נאות: התמיכה שלך עוזרת להפעיל את האתר! אנו מרוויחים דמי הפניה עבור חלק מהשירותים שאנו ממליצים עליהם בדף זה.


MS-Windows הוא ממשק משתמש גרפי (GUI) שפותח ומשווק על ידי חברת מיקרוסופט. לרוב מכונה בפשטות “Windows”, הוא מייצג משפחה של מערכות הפעלה מבוססות גרפיקה שעלו לגדולה בסוף שנות השמונים ותחילת שנות התשעים. לא תהיה זו הגזמה מרומזת כי ההתפתחות של מיקרוסופט ווינדוס סייעה להוביל את מהפכת המחשבים הביתיים האישיים, וההערכה היא שכיום כמעט 90% מכל מכשירי המחשוב המסחריים מנהלים איזושהי מערכת הפעלה של חלונות..

משורת הפקודה לממשק גרפי

לפני פיתוח ממשק המשתמש הגרפי, מחשבים אישיים הסתמכו על מערכות הפעלה של משתמש יחיד / משימות יחיד באמצעות ממשק שורת פקודה בסיסי (CLI) לכל הפעולות. דוגמא עיקרית לכך היא MS-DOS, מוצר אחר של מיקרוסופט שעדיין רואה שירות תומך כיום בפעולות רקע עבור יישומי Windows רבים. עם CLI משתמשים נדרשים להזין פקודות טקסט לכל הפעולות, שלמרות שהן אפקטיביות לא היו ידידותיות במיוחד למשתמש (במיוחד לבעלי כישורי מחשוב מוגבלים). פיתוח ממשק המשתמש הגרפי שינה את כל זה.

היסטוריה

בשנת 1983, ביל גייטס ופול אלן הודיעו על פיתוח מערכת ההפעלה הראשונה מבוססת הגרפיקה של מיקרוסופט. המערכת נקראה במקור בשם “מנהל הממשק”, והניחה את הקרקע למה שיהפוך לתכונות המגדירות של חלונות – תפריטים נפתחים, פסי גלילה, תיבות דו-שיח, אייקונים ידידותיים למשתמש וכמובן, חלונות בכל מקום של מערכת ההפעלה. בשנת 1985, Windows 1.0 ראתה שחרור כללי והוחלפה במהירות על ידי ההשקות הבאות של Windows 2.0 ו- 3.0. בשלב זה, מערכת ההפעלה Windows הייתה בעיקר פגז גרפי שעלה על גבי MS-DOS. מיקרוסופט תמשיך לפתח גרסה מוקדמת זו של Windows, תוך הצגת התקדמות בזיכרון הווירטואלי ומנהלי התקנים לכל אורך גרסת 3.1.

ההתקדמות הגדולה הבאה במערכת ההפעלה Windows הגיעה עם שחרורו של Windows 95. למרות שעדיין מבוססת MS-DOS, איטרציה זו הביאה יציבות רבה יותר למערכת ההפעלה והציגה תמיכה ביישומי 32 סיביות, פונקציות ריבוי משימות ושמות קבצים ארוכים. Windows 95 ראתה גם את הגעתו של ממשק המשתמש היותר ידידותי לאובייקט, הכולל את תפריט ההפעלה הסטנדרטי כעת (החלפת מנהל התוכניות הקיים), שורת המשימות ומעטפת סייר Windows. איטרציות לאחר מכן, במיוחד Windows 98 ו- Windows ME (Millennium Edition), ראו שיפורים נוספים במערכת, כולל זמני אתחול מהירים יותר, הגנה משופרת על קבצי המערכת ופונקציות שחזור המערכת. כאן אנו מתחילים לראות הצגת תכונות ממוקדות יותר מבחינה מסחרית כמו דפדפן האינטרנט של Internet Explorer של מיקרוסופט ופונקציות מולטימדיה כמו Movie Maker ו- Microsoft Media Player..

Windows NT

עם התפתחות ושחרור של הגרסאות הקודמות המבוססות על MS-DOS ל- Windows, החלה העבודה על גרסה מעודכנת של מערכת ההפעלה של מיקרוסופט ושל מערכת ההפעלה IBM / IBM. זו תהיה מערכת הפעלה מרובת משתמשים מאובטחת יותר עם תאימות POSIX (ממשק מערכת הפעלה ניידת) עם ריבוי משימות מקדימות ותמיכה בארכיטקטורות מעבד מרובות. המכונה NT OS / 2 (המיועד ל- NT ל”טכנולוגיה חדשה “), זה בסופו של דבר ישתלב ב- Windows NT 3.1, מערכת ההפעלה הראשונה של 32 סיביות של מיקרוסופט. NT 3.1 שוחרר בשנת 1993, היה זמין הן לתחנות עבודה ביתיות והן לשרתים וסימן את הצגת מערכת הקבצים NTFS של מיקרוסופט, שיפור ביחס לתקן FAT הקיים. במובנים רבים, Windows NT 3.1 הוא המראה הראשון של פלטפורמת Windows המוכרת לנו כיום, ובסוף מתנתק מהגרסאות הישנות יותר המבוססות על MS-DOS של מערכת ההפעלה..

ההתרחקות ממערכת הפעלה מבוססת MS-DOS הביאה בסופו של דבר להשקה של Windows XP, הגרסה העיקרית הראשונה של פלטפורמת Windows NT. במקור ששווק במהדורות “ביתיות” וגם “מקצועיות”, Windows XP כלל מספר התקדמות קריטית למערכת ההפעלה של מיקרוסופט. המערכת החדשה כללה ממשק משתמש שעוצב מחדש, ביצועים משופרים לעומת גרסאות ישנות מבוססות MS-DOS, פונקציות ריבוי משימות מתקדמות ותכונות מולטימדיה ורשת משופרות. העברת קדימה של כל מערכות ההפעלה Windows של מיקרוסופט תתבסס על מודל NT, כאשר המשך המחקר והפיתוח יובילו ל- Windows Vista בשנת 2007, Windows 7 בשנת 2009 (בעיקר התייחסות לתיקוני באגים עבור Vista), ו- Windows 8 בשנת 2012 (הבאת משופרת תכונות ביצועים למכשירים ניידים). 2015 הושק ב- Windows 10, האיטרציה האחרונה של מערכת ההפעלה של מיקרוסופט, שהציגה ממשק משתמש מחודש עם שולחן עבודה וירטואלי, פונקציות ריבוי משימות חדשות ותכונות אבטחה משופרות..

אמולטורים וחלופות

MS-Windows, על כל האיטרציות הרבות שלה, הוכיחה את עצמה כמערכת ההפעלה הפופולרית ביותר בשוק. פופולריות זו הביאה באופן טבעי לפיתוח יישומים שנועדו להפוך את Windows לתואם עם מערכות הפעלה אחרות. חלק מאלו פועלים כשכבות תאימות פשוטות שנועדו לאפשר ליישומי Windows לפעול במערכת הפעלה אחרת, ואילו אחרים פותחו כמערכות עצמאיות שיכולות להריץ את חלונות Windows מהקופסה..

כמה מהאמולטורים והחלופות הבולטים ביותר עבור MS-Windows כוללים:

  • Parallels Desktop for Mac – הדבר מאפשר למשתמשים ב- Mac להריץ מערכות הפעלה של חלונות ולינוקס ופונקציות קריטיות בשילוב עם מערכת ההפעלה Mac בכל מכשיר Apple המופעל על ידי Intel;
  • יין – אמולציה בחינם של קוד פתוח של ממשק ה- API מאפשרת למשתמשים להריץ יישומי Windows בכל מערכת הפעלה מבוססת יוניקס;
  • ReactOS – מערכת הפעלה בקוד פתוח המיועדת לחקות את Windows NT 4.0 ומסוגלת להריץ תוכנת Windows;
  • Linspire – שנקראה בעבר LindowsOS, Linspire היא מערכת הפעלה מבוססת לינוקס המיועדת להפעלת תוכנת Windows.

ספרים

עם ההיסטוריה הארוכה של Windows מגיע מספר ספרים המוקדשים לגרסאות שונות של מערכת ההפעלה. חלקם הם מבוא בסיסי לפלטפורמה עם דגש על צרכיהם של המשתמשים היומיומיים, בעוד שאחרים ממוקדים יותר טכנית ומכוונים לתכנתים ומומחי IT..

  • נקודות מבט חדשות על שורת הפקודה MS-DOS של מיקרוסופט Windows 2000, מקיף, משופרת Windows XP (2002) של פיליפס וסקגרברג – אף על פי שהוא מיושן מעט, ספר העיון הזה מספק מבוא מוצק לאיתרציות הקודמות של מערכת ההפעלה Windows. דגש מושם על ממשקי שורת פקודה, וחלונות כקונכייה גרפית עבור MS-DOS. תוספת חומר במערכת Windows XP עוקבת אחר המעבר ל- GUI מבוסס 32 סיביות לחלוטין.
  • Windows 8.1 for Dummies (2013) מאת אנדי רת’בונה – חלק מהזכיינית הפופולרית “… for Dummies”, ספר זה מכסה את השדרוגים הנוכחיים שהופיעו אז ב- Windows 8.1. הנושאים כוללים מכניקה בסיסית, אחסון קבצים ועבודה עם ממשקים כפולים. הדגש הוא על שימוש יומיומי יותר מאשר היבטים תכנותיים של מערכת ההפעלה, אם כי הספר אכן נוגע בחלק מההיבטים הטכניים יותר של Windows 8.1..
  • מדריך ל- Windows 7 ו- Vista לכלי סקריפט, אוטומציה וכלי שורת פקודה (2010) מאת בריאן קניטל – מדריך זה מיושן במידה מסוימת עם ההתמקדות שלו ב- Windows 7 ובמהלך המהדורה הנוכחית של ויסטה. עם זאת, הדגש שלה על תכנות ופרטים טכניים של מערכת ההפעלה הוא עדיין בעל ערך עבור מפתחי תוכנה ומהנדסי מחשבים. הנושאים כוללים הבנת מארח סקריפטים של Windows בסביבת ה- scripting החדשה של Windows, עבודה עם VBScript, JScript ו- ActivePerl וניווט בממשק הניהול של Windows..
  • Windows 10 Simplified (2015) על ידי Paul McFedries – עם השקת Windows 10 מיקרוסופט ביצעה כמה שינויים גדולים במערכת ההפעלה הבסיסית של Windows. מדריך עזר זה מיועד בעיקר למשתמשים בהשכבה, ומשמש כמבוא לאיטרציה האחרונה של מערכת ההפעלה Windows.
  • מושגי מערכת הפעלה (2012) מאת Silberschatz, et al – אף שאינו רלוונטי לחלוטין ל- Windows, ספר זה אמור לפנות למעוניינים בתכנון ופונקציה של מערכות הפעלה ממוחשבות מודרניות. המהדורה המעודכנת הזו, שפורסמה בשנת 2012, בוחנת מערכות הפעלה עכשוויות ומספקת תרגילי סוף פרק וסקירת שאלות כדי לעזור לקורא להשתלט על מושגי תכנות חשובים..

סיכום

חלונות של מיקרוסופט מלווים אותנו, בצורה כזו או אחרת, כבר יותר משלושים שנה. הצלחתה כמערכת הפעלה ברת קיימא מסחרית הפכה את מיקרוסופט לענקית התוכנה שהיא כיום, ולמרות שתמיד יהיו אתגרים לכתר Windows נותרה מערכת ההפעלה הפופולרית ביותר בשוק. לפי הערכה אחרונה, כ -90% מכל מחשוב העולם נעשה על מכונות שמפעילות צורה כלשהי של MS-Windows. אין ספק, מיקרוסופט תמשיך לפתח את מערכת ההפעלה שלה, תוך הצגת תכונות וחידודים חדשים, מתוך כוונה לשמור על חלונות בחזית המחשוב הביתי והעסקי..

המשך קריאה ומשאבים

יש לנו מדריכים נוספים, הדרכות ואינפוגרפיות הקשורים לשימוש במחשבים:

  • תכנות רשת עם שקעי אינטרנט: למד הכל על רשת מחשבים.
  • תכנות לינוקס מבוא ומשאבים: הצלילה העמוקה הזו לתכנות לינוקס יורדת לליבה בה כל הפעולה היא.

משאבי תכנות יוניקס

MS-DOS הוא מאוד אחיה הפשוט יותר של יוניקס. אז אם אתם רוצים לעבור ל- Unix, יש לנו מקום נהדר עבורכם להתחיל ללמוד: משאבי תכנות Unix.

הרשימה האולטימטיבית של כלי מנהלי האתרים A-Z
משאבי תכנות יוניקס

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map